GREENWICH, Conn. — Long delays were reported Wednesday morning on the New Haven Line after a person was hit by a train in Port Chester, N.Y., Metro-North said. 

Service between Rye and Greenwich is experiencing delays of 30 to 40 minutes at 7:45 a.m. Wednesday, Metro-North said. 

Customers at Rye, Port Chester and Greenwich who want to travel eastbound must board a westbound train to Harrison to catch a train for eastbound service. 

No further information was released on the incident by Metro-North.
